
Energy Snaps Its Winning Streak… What’s Next?
For the first week since the war in Iran began, a sector other than energy led the market higher.
In fact, the State Street Energy Select Sector SPDR ETF (XLE) was the worst-performing sector last week, down 3.7%.
Most sectors were higher, with the State Street Real Estate Select Sector SPDR ETF (XLRE) leading the pack, up 3.3%. The S&P 500 Index was up 1.7% on the week, breaking its losing streak.
Is the epic run in energy over?
